Understanding Your Target Audience

Designing an accountant website in Austin requires a nuanced understanding of your target audience. The city is a melting pot of diverse demographics, from innovative tech startups in the Domain to the eclectic artists of South Congress. Tailoring your website to speak directly to these varied groups can significantly enhance engagement. Consider the following key points:

  • Identify your primary clients: Are you primarily serving individuals, small businesses, or larger corporations? Each group has distinct needs and expectations that should shape your design approach. For instance, small business owners may appreciate straightforward, no-nonsense navigation, while individuals might value a more personal touch in design.
  • Reflect the local culture: Infuse Austin's vibrant colors, local art, and music references into your design. Utilize imagery of iconic landmarks like the Texas State Capitol or South Congress Avenue to create a sense of familiarity and connection with your audience.
  • Offer clear navigation: Structure your site so visitors can effortlessly find what they need—services, contact information, and client testimonials should be just a click away. Consider implementing a sticky menu that remains visible as users scroll, ensuring essential links are always accessible.

Essential Features for Your Accountant Website

Your accountant website should serve as a comprehensive resource for both you and your clients. Incorporating essential features will not only enhance user experience but also streamline your operations. Here are some must-have elements:

  • Professional design: A clean, modern layout not only looks appealing but also builds trust with visitors. Use white space strategically to create a sense of organization and professionalism.
  • Mobile responsiveness: With more individuals accessing websites via smartphones and tablets, ensure that your site is fully responsive. Test your design across various devices and screen sizes to guarantee a seamless experience.
  • Client portal: A secure client portal allows clients to access important documents, manage their accounts, and communicate with you directly. This feature not only enhances convenience but also demonstrates your commitment to client privacy and security.
  • Blog section: Establish your expertise by regularly sharing valuable insights through a blog. Offer tax tips, financial advice, and updates on local financial events. This not only attracts potential clients but also helps with SEO.

Local SEO Best Practices

To stand out in Austin's competitive accounting landscape, optimizing your website for local search is essential. Here’s how to effectively enhance your local SEO:

  • Incorporate local keywords: Use phrases like "accountant in Austin" or "financial services in South Austin" throughout your content. Be mindful to integrate these keywords naturally into your text to maintain readability.
  • Create location-specific pages: If your services extend to various neighborhoods, consider creating individual pages for each area. This not only helps with SEO but also enables you to address the unique concerns and needs of clients in those specific locales.
  • Claim your Google My Business listing: This vital step helps your firm appear prominently in local search results and Google Maps. Make sure to keep your listing updated with accurate contact information, business hours, and engaging photos that highlight your office and team.

Showcasing Testimonials and Case Studies

Building client trust is paramount in the accounting profession. Showcasing client testimonials and insightful case studies can provide the social proof necessary to encourage potential clients to reach out. Here’s how to effectively feature this content on your website:

  • Highlight specific results: Avoid generic praise; instead, share measurable outcomes that demonstrate your impact. For example, detail how you helped a local business reduce their tax liability or improve their financial forecasting.
  • Use visuals: Incorporate photographs of clients or infographics that illustrate your services and their outcomes. Visual storytelling can significantly enhance the relatability of your testimonials.
  • Regular updates: Keep your testimonials fresh and relevant to reflect your current client base. Periodically reach out to clients for updated feedback to ensure your testimonials remain current and relatable.
